How do you let go of being frustrated with hitting a bad shot or missing?

In this week's tennis psychology podcast, mental game of tennis expert, Dr. Patrick Cohn answers a question from Tammy.

Here's what Tammy had to say about his game:

"How can I let go of felling so frustrated when I miss shots? I'm a 3.5 player and love the game. When others miss shots or hit unforced errors, I'm super encouraging and positive but when I do it it's like I am so hard on myself and which effects my performance."

Listen to the podcast to hear what Dr. Cohn has to say about coping with bad shots and misses in a tennis game.
